如何在CentOS 7上安装MySQL数据库

2023年 8月 9日 44.6k 0

  • 本文目录导读:
  • 1、前言
  • 2、步骤一:安装MySQL服务器
  • 3、步骤二:启动MySQL服务器
  • 4、步骤三:设置MySQL根密码
  • 5、步骤四:登录MySQL
  • 6、步骤五:创建新用户
  • 7、步骤六:授予用户权限
  • 8、为您分享

前言

MySQL是一个流行的开源关系型数据库管理系统,它是Web应用程序和网站的首选数据库之一。在本文中,我们将学习如何在CentOS 7上安装MySQL数据库。

步骤一:安装MySQL服务器

第一步是安装MySQL服务器。为此,打开终端并键入以下命令:

```

sudo yum install mysql-server

这将安装MySQL服务器软件包及其依赖项。

步骤二:启动MySQL服务器

安装MySQL服务器后,需要启动它。要启动MySQL服务器,请键入以下命令:

sudo systemctl start mysqld

如果您想在系统启动时自动启动MySQL服务器,请键入以下命令:

sudo systemctl enable mysqld

步骤三:设置MySQL根密码

MySQL服务器已启动,但您还需要设置根密码。要设置根密码,请键入以下命令:

sudo mysql_secure_installation

此命令将提示您输入新的根密码。输入密码后,按Enter键。

接下来,您将被要求删除匿名用户、禁用远程根登录以及删除测试数据库。按照提示操作即可。

步骤四:登录MySQL

现在,您可以使用以下命令登录MySQL:

mysql -u root -p

此命令将提示您输入MySQL根密码。输入密码后,按Enter键。

步骤五:创建新用户

现在,您已经成功登录MySQL,可以创建新用户。要创建新用户,请键入以下命令:

C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';

此命令将创建一个名为“newuser”的新用户,并为该用户设置密码。

步骤六:授予用户权限

现在,您已经创建了新用户,但该用户目前没有任何权限。要授予用户权限,请键入以下命令:

GRANT ALL PRIVILEGES ON * . * TO 'newuser'@'localhost';

此命令将授予新用户在所有数据库和所有表上执行所有操作的权限。

在本文中,我们学习了如何在CentOS 7上安装MySQL数据库,并创建了一个新用户并授予了该用户权限。现在,您可以开始使用MySQL数据库了!

为您分享

作为一个Linux用户,您可能已经知道如何使用“sudo”命令以管理员身份运行命令。但是,您知道如何使用“sudo !!”命令吗?这个命令将重新运行上一个命令,但是以管理员身份运行。这可以节省您的时间,并使您更快地完成任务。

相关文章

服务器端口转发,带你了解服务器端口转发
服务器开放端口,服务器开放端口的步骤
产品推荐:7月受欢迎AI容器镜像来了,有Qwen系列大模型镜像
如何使用 WinGet 下载 Microsoft Store 应用
百度搜索:蓝易云 – 熟悉ubuntu apt-get命令详解
百度搜索:蓝易云 – 域名解析成功但ping不通解决方案

发布评论